Espag

There are a variety of window handles that are available on the market. The most popular type that is found in the UK is the espag handle. This kind of window handle is typically used in aluminum, uPVC, timber and wood windows.

The espag shape of window handles is similar to the Venetian style. It has a flat metal strip on the front of the handle. The handle is usually attached to the window's front by two bolts or screws.

Depending on your personal preferences There are a variety of styles of espag handle available on the market. Some handles have a crank that allows users to turn the handle in one direction. Some handles can be rotated clockwise or anticlockwise by either being left or right-handed.

Espag Upvc replacement window handles are available in a variety of colors. They also come with a variety of features, including keys locking mechanisms. You can buy replacement uPVC handles in 15mm to 55mm sizes. Typically the replacement uPVC window handle is finished in white standard.

If you need to replace your espag window handles it is recommended to pick a top quality product. Handles that aren't of the highest quality could break or cause damage to the spindle pivoting areas.

You can also find a replacement uPVC handle with magnetic spindles. They are simple to install. Alternately, you could purchase a handle inline. These handles are more stylish.

You can modify replacement uPVC handles to fit different window systems. They are generally designed to be 43mm in diameter.

Cockspur

Cockspur Upvc window handles are a well-known choice. They are a good alternative to the lever handle that is traditional and will fit almost any style of window. This handle was common in uPVC windows since the early days. It is still in use regularly. The modern day handle features an extended 20mm nosepiece, as well as the locking mechanism locks to the transom bar cross-member.

There's a lot buzz around the modern handle for cockspurs and a few companies have come out with a more traditional handle that can be used on timber and uPVC. Yale Securistyle Virage Cockspur Handle is one such handle. It is suitable for both aluminum and timber windows. It's an extremely well-engineered handle, with a top-quality locking deadlock and a slim grip. It can be deadlocked using the key supplied.

It's up to you what you like, you may prefer the nimble finger of the nipper or the tactile feel of the handle. There are a number of cockspur handles made of uPVC, including Cotswold Cotspurs that are set in 38 or 58mm positions. Many uPVC versions include a multi-function lever that locks the transom and frame. These are often a more suitable option for windows that do not need to be serviced as frequently.

The Yale Securistyle Virage Cockspur is the perfect match for timber and aluminum windows. It is fitted with a high-quality deadlock lock cylinder, as well as an elegant grip.

Turn and tilt

Tilt and turn windows are a great option for homeowners. They're easy to use, convenient, and provide healthy ventilation. The mechanism for opening is secure and fast.

You can choose from a range of styles and materials , including wood, aluminum, and uPVC. Wooden frames can rot over time, while aluminum and composite window frames need little maintenance. UPVC tilt and turn window frames are cheaper than aluminum and timber frames.

A tilt and turn window is able to be closed and opened in a single motion. They can be adjusted to permit high or slow air flow. For example, you can open them in the evening or during a hot summer day. It takes only about two to five minutes to adjust the window.

The handle is among the most crucial components of a window. There are two screw heads located at the top of the handle. You can use a measuring tape to measure the distance between the screw holes. It's usually 43mm from the center to the center.

Choose a design that is compatible with your existing window handles if trying to replace them. The same design will increase the reliability of your window handles.

The locking mechanism is another essential component of a tilt and turn window. The handle is equipped with a tiny gearbox that is attached to it. These windows are extremely secure.

A professional contractor should be consulted when you need a replacement. Replacement uPVC tilt and turn window handles have wider bases and typically have a square spindle of seven millimetres in the rear. This offers more durability and strength than a metal or wooden handle.
